44/* maximum MD size estimate (in bytes) */
45#define MD_MAX_SIZE (64 * 1024)
46
47/** element types (element tag values) */
48#define LIST_END 0x0 /**< End of element list */
49#define NODE 0x4e /**< Start of node definition */
50#define NODE_END 0x45 /**< End of node definition */
51#define NOOP 0x20 /**< NOOP list element - to be ignored */
52#define PROP_ARC 0x61 /**< Node property arc'ing to another node */
53#define PROP_VAL 0x76 /**< Node property with an integer value */
54#define PROP_STR 0x73 /**< Node property with a string value */
55#define PROP_DATA 0x64 /**< Node property with a block of data */
56
57
58/** machine description header */
59typedef struct {
60 uint32_t transport_version; /**< Transport version number */
61 uint32_t node_blk_sz; /**< Size in bytes of node block */
62 uint32_t name_blk_sz; /**< Size in bytes of name block */
63 uint32_t data_blk_sz; /**< Size in bytes of data block */
64} __attribute__ ((packed)) md_header_t;
65
66/** machine description element (in the node block) */
67typedef struct {
68 uint8_t tag; /**< Type of element */
69 uint8_t name_len; /**< Length in bytes of element name */
70 uint16_t _reserved_field; /**< reserved field (zeros) */
71 uint32_t name_offset; /**< Location offset of name associated
72 with this element relative to
73 start of name block */
74 union {
75 /** for elements of type “PROP_STR” and of type “PROP_DATA” */
76 struct {
77 /** Length in bytes of data in data block */
78 uint32_t data_len;
79
80 /**
81 * Location offset of data associated with this
82 * element relative to start of data block
83 */
84 uint32_t data_offset;
85 } y;
86
87 /**
88 * 64 bit value for elements of tag type “NODE”, “PROP_VAL”
89 * or “PROP_ARC”
90 */
91 uint64_t val;
92 } d;
93} __attribute__ ((packed)) md_element_t;
94
95/** index of the element within the node block */
96typedef unsigned int element_idx_t;
97
98/** buffer to which the machine description will be saved */
99static uint8_t mach_desc[MD_MAX_SIZE]
100 __attribute__ ((aligned (16)));
101
102
103/** returns pointer to the element at the given index */
104static md_element_t *get_element(element_idx_t idx)
105{
106 return (md_element_t *) (mach_desc +
107 sizeof(md_header_t) + idx * sizeof(md_element_t));
108}
109
110/** returns the name of the element represented by the index */
111static const char *get_element_name(element_idx_t idx)
112{
113 md_header_t *md_header = (md_header_t *) mach_desc;
114 uintptr_t name_offset = get_element(idx)->name_offset;
115 return (char *) mach_desc + sizeof(md_header_t) +
116 md_header->node_blk_sz + name_offset;
117}
118
119/** finds the name of the node represented by "node" */
120const char *md_get_node_name(md_node_t node)
121{
122 return get_element_name(node);
123}
124
125/**
126 * Returns the value of the integer property of the given node.
127 *
128 * @param
129 */
130bool md_get_integer_property(md_node_t node, const char *key,
131 uint64_t *result)
132{
133 element_idx_t idx = node;
134
135 while (get_element(idx)->tag != NODE_END) {
136 idx++;
137 md_element_t *element = get_element(idx);
138 if (element->tag == PROP_VAL &&
139 str_cmp(key, get_element_name(idx)) == 0) {
140 *result = element->d.val;
141 return true;
142 }
143 }
144
145 return false;
146}
147
148/**
149 * Returns the value of the string property of the given node.
150 *
151 * @param
152 */
153bool md_get_string_property(md_node_t node, const char *key,
154 const char **result)
155{
156 md_header_t *md_header = (md_header_t *) mach_desc;
157 element_idx_t idx = node;
158
159 while (get_element(idx)->tag != NODE_END) {
160 idx++;
161 md_element_t *element = get_element(idx);
162 if (element->tag == PROP_DATA &&
163 str_cmp(key, get_element_name(idx)) == 0) {
164 *result = (char *) mach_desc + sizeof(md_header_t) +
165 md_header->node_blk_sz + md_header->name_blk_sz +
166 element->d.y.data_offset;
167 return true;
168 }
169 }
170
171 return false;
172}
173
174/**
175 * Moves the child oterator to the next child (following sibling of the node
176 * the oterator currently points to).
177 *
178 * @param it pointer to the iterator to be moved
179 */
180bool md_next_child(md_child_iter_t *it)
181{
182 element_idx_t backup = *it;
183
184 while (get_element(*it)->tag != NODE_END) {
185 (*it)++;
186 md_element_t *element = get_element(*it);
187 if (element->tag == PROP_ARC &&
188 str_cmp("fwd", get_element_name(*it)) == 0) {
189 return true;
190 }
191 }
192
193 *it = backup;
194 return false;
195}
196
197/**
198 * Returns the node the iterator point to.
199 */
200md_node_t md_get_child_node(md_child_iter_t it)
201{
202 return get_element(it)->d.val;
203}
204
205/**
206 * Helper function used to split a string to a part before the first
207 * slash sign and a part after the slash sign.
208 *
209 * @param str pointer to the string to be split; when the function finishes,
210 * it will contain only the part following the first slash sign of
211 * the original string
212 * @param head pointer to the string which will be set to the part before the
213 * first slash sign
214 */
215static bool str_parse_head(char **str, char **head)
216{
217 *head = *str;
218
219 char *cur = *str;
220 while (*cur != '\0') {
221 if (*cur == '/') {
222 *cur = '\0';
223 *str = cur + 1;
224 return true;
225 }
226 cur++;
227 }
228
229 return false;
230}
231
232/**
233 * Returns the descendant of the given node. The descendant is identified
234 * by a path where the node names are separated by a slash.
235 *
236 * Ex.: Let there be a node N with path "a/b/c/x/y/z" and let P represent the
237 * node with path "a/b/c". Then md_get_child(P, "x/y/z") will return N.
238 */
239md_node_t md_get_child(md_node_t node, char *name)
240{
241 bool more;
242
243 do {
244 char *head;
245 more = str_parse_head(&name, &head);
246
247 while (md_next_child(&node)) {
248 element_idx_t child = md_get_child_node(node);
249 if (str_cmp(head, get_element_name(child)) == 0) {
250 node = child;
251 break;
252 }
253 }
254
255 } while (more);
256
257 return node;
258}
259
260/** returns the root node of MD */
261md_node_t md_get_root(void)
262{
263 return 0;
264}
265
266/**
267 * Returns the child iterator - a token to be passed to functions iterating
268 * through all the children of a node.
269 *
270 * @param node a node whose children the iterator will be used
271 * to iterate through
272 */
273md_child_iter_t md_get_child_iterator(md_node_t node)
274{
275 return node;
276}
277
278/**
279 * Moves "node" to the node following "node" in the list of all the existing
280 * nodes of the MD whose name is "name".
281 */
282bool md_next_node(md_node_t *node, const char *name)
283{
284 md_element_t *element;
285 (*node)++;
286
287 do {
288 element = get_element(*node);
289
290 if (element->tag == NODE &&
291 str_cmp(name, get_element_name(*node)) == 0) {
292 return true;
293 }
294
295 (*node)++;
296 } while (element->tag != LIST_END);
297
298 return false;
299}
300
301/**
302 * Retrieves the machine description from the hypervisor and saves it to
303 * a kernel buffer.
304 */
305void md_init(void)
306{
307 uint64_t retval = __hypercall_fast2(MACH_DESC, KA2PA(mach_desc),
308 MD_MAX_SIZE);
309
310 retval = retval;
311 if (retval != HV_EOK) {
312 printf("Could not retrieve machine description, "
313 "error=%" PRIu64 ".\n", retval);
314 }
315}
316
